Speaking of MTV, let's delve into a little history, shall we? In 1981, this little network almost single handedly changed the face of the music industry. And I mean, radically, radically changed. Overnight this little network no one knew became a household name. If you want new, fresh music, if you want to produce a 'cool' image MTV was and is the place to launch it.

"They became keepers of the industry, took small time muscians and made them more popular face than they ever were. MTV has also been, to no surprise, credited for encouraging bad behaviour in teenagers. Do you lot agree with this statement?
